Item text
An ordinance of the mayor and city commission of the city of miami beach, florida, amending chapter 2 of the code of the city of miami beach, entitled “administration,” article iii, “agencies, boards and committees,” division 1, “generally,” by amending section 2-22, “general requirements,” to require that all applicants for appointment to a city agency, board, or committee submit a résumé or curriculum vitae (cv), as well as a statement of interest, and that applicants for positions with professional or employment qualifications submit evidence of licensure or other relevant experience; and providing for repealer, codification, severability, and an effective date. 11:00 a.m. First reading public hearing applicable area: citywide city attorney commissioner tanya k. Bhatt
